Don't worry, it’s okay if you don’t believe in the afterlife, because the people who live there don’t believe in you either . . .
What if you went to heaven and no one there believed in Earth? This is the question at the heart of Beforelife, a satirical novel that follows the post-mortem adventures of widower Ian Brown, a man who dies on the book’s first page and finds himself in an afterlife where no one else believes in 'pre-incarnation.'
